I'm slowly trying to > learn it, but I had a question - what is the appropriate object to > subclass to create a "mega widget" ie A listbox with it's add/delete > buttons already built in? > > wxPanel seems a possibility - any thoughts?
When I've created this type of thing I usually start with a wx.Panel. It will depend on how you plan to use your new mega-widget, but I suspect that the wx.Panel gives you the most flexibility. You can throw a panel pretty much anywhere and it seems to work just fine. :) PS: Congrats on giving wxPython a try.
